Improved Usage Speed with Latest IT and Content Applications

Effective June 1, Relaunch Event Also Held

Ulsan City is revamping the ‘Ulsan Bus Information Mobile App (U-Bus)’ for the first time in 12 years.


On May 31, Ulsan City announced that starting June 1, the ‘existing app’ will be operated in parallel to minimize confusion among current users.


The ‘Ulsan Bus Information Mobile App’ is a service that allows citizens to check bus arrival times on their smartphones without having to go to the bus stop, and it has been in operation since 2011.


It is a popular public app with 70,000 downloads annually and up to 800,000 daily accesses.

The main updates include fixing the slow speed and various errors of the existing app, improving the interface by reflecting the latest IT technologies and trends, enhancing usage speed through system optimization, reflecting changes in transportation conditions such as transfers on the Donghae Nambu Line, and developing a boarding and alighting alarm service that notifies users when the bus departs from the previous stop.


The route-finding feature uses Kakao Map to provide directions to the destination, as well as information on which bus to take and arrival times.


Additionally, it includes traffic information, event announcements, and favorite destinations for visitors to Ulsan such as the 12 scenic spots of Ulsan, cultural heritage sites, and quick links to government offices.


From June 5 to 16, Ulsan City will conduct a satisfaction survey as part of a ‘revamp event’ and plans to send mobile coffee coupons worth 5,000 won to the first 300 participants.



To participate, users can download ‘Ulsan Bus Information (Ver2.0)’ distributed by the Ulsan Transportation Management Center from Google Play or the iPhone App Store, then enter the satisfaction survey and personal information through the event notification window.
